Question: A current of 10 ampere is flowing in a wire of length 1.5 m. A force of 15 N acts on it when it is placed in a uniform magnetic field of 2 tesla. The angle between the magnetic field and the direction of the current is [MP PMT 1994]

Options:

A) $ 30{}^\circ $

B) $ 45{}^\circ $

C) $ 60{}^\circ $

D) $ 90{}^\circ $

Show Answer

Answer:

Correct Answer: A

Solution:

$ F=Bil\sin \theta \Rightarrow \sin \theta =\frac{F}{Bil}=\frac{15}{2\times 10\times 1.5}=\frac{1}{2} $

Þ $ \theta =30{}^\circ $
